Overview

Sonia is heading the Technology, Media and Telecommunications team of Linklaters in Paris. Sonia’s practice covers the full range of TMT legal areas, with a focus on contracts, data protection, internet and telecommunications. Sonia has strong experience in advising companies from diversified sectors (IT editors and service providers, banking, insurance, transportation, telecom, energy, retail, luxe, etc.) across all aspects of major commercial contracts, sourcing and complex procurement transactions, regulation of data and networks, e-business and IT security, telecoms and media projects. Her experience has led her to advise on both service providers and clients’ sides.

Sonia is an active member of l’Association Française du Droit de l’Informatique, IAPP, Fratel, Women in AI and the Global Sourcing Association.

Work highlights 

Sonia has gained important experience in advising client on data protection and information governance matters. She has advised major companies in a brand range of industry sectors on various types of global data protection projects.

Her recent experience includes:

  • a leading designer, manufacturer and distributor of ophthalmic lenses and equipment for eye care professionals, on its global compliance program to the GDPR and other local regulations, involving more than 60 entities across North America, South America, Asia and Europe
  • an international banking group with a presence in 75 countries, on its compliance program with the General Data Protection Regulation by drafting all its internal guidelines for data processing
  • an American manufacturer of lead-acid batteries, including automotive batteries and industrial batteries, on its compliance program to the GDPR, involving entities in Europe and North America 
  • a high-performing digital and IT service company on the review of its Information Systems Security Charter applicable to subcontractors ensuring compliance with the GDPR
  • negotiating an outsourcing agreement for the implementation of an IT platform and the provision of BPO services 
  • drafting and negotiating an integration and SaaS agreement for a British multinational banking and financial services company
  • drafting of a standard agreement for an international banking group with a presence in 75 countries to oversee its relations with external service providers for the provision of development, data hosting and outsourcing services 
  • drafting a service agreement for a leading distributor of light and commercial vehicle parts for the development of a cloud based software platform for the management of distributor and garage networks
     

Professional experience

Her personal experience includes assisting a French retail company during its software compliance audit and during the following litigation against a well-known service provider; an energy company on the management of its contractual relationships with its service provider for the development of a smart metering system; negotiating video agreements for the provision of content in a digital entertainment content ecosystem with several US cinema studios; advising a cosmetic company for the protection of its self-developed software in France and in the United States.

Education and qualifications

Sonia holds a Master in Intellectual Property Law from the University Montpellier I and a LLM in International Business Law from Kings College London.

She is admitted at the Paris Bar. Sonia speaks French, English and Spanish fluently.
